What is the Best Practice for Controlling Agricultural Pests?

Agricultural pests pose a significant threat to crop production and food security worldwide. To ensure sustainable agriculture and protect our food supply, it is crucial to adopt the best practices for controlling these pests. This article will explore various strategies and techniques that are considered most effective in managing agricultural pests.

Monitoring and Early Warning Systems

The first line of defense against agricultural pests is monitoring and early warning systems. By regularly monitoring crop fields and using advanced technologies such as drones and remote sensing, farmers can detect pest infestations at an early stage. Early warning systems allow for timely interventions, minimizing the spread and impact of pests. This proactive approach is crucial in managing pests effectively.

Integrated Pest Management (IPM)

Integrated Pest Management (IPM) is a holistic approach that combines multiple pest control methods to achieve long-term, sustainable pest management. IPM emphasizes the use of non-chemical methods such as biological control, cultural practices, and physical barriers, with the judicious use of pesticides as a last resort. This approach not only reduces reliance on chemicals but also enhances the ecosystem's natural ability to control pests.

Biological Control

Biological control involves using natural enemies of pests, such as predators, parasites, and pathogens, to reduce pest populations. Contohnya, ladybugs are often used to control aphids, and Trichogramma wasps are employed against various lepidopteran pests. Biological control is an environmentally friendly method that can provide long-term pest suppression without causing harm to non-target organisms.

Cultural Practices

Cultural practices, such as crop rotation, intercropping, and the use of resistant varieties, can significantly reduce pest pressure. Crop rotation disrupts the pest's life cycle by preventing them from building up populations on the same crop year after year. Intercropping, Sebaliknya, creates a more diverse ecosystem that can support a wider range of natural enemies, thus providing natural pest control. Di samping itu, using pest-resistant crop varieties can reduce the need for pesticides.

Physical Control Methods

Physical control methods involve the use of mechanical or physical barriers to prevent pest infestations. This can include the use of traps, barriers, and other physical means to exclude or remove pests. Contohnya, row covers can be used to physically exclude insect pests from young plants, and pheromone traps can be employed to monitor and reduce pest populations.

Chemical Control

While chemical pesticides are often viewed as a last resort, they can be effective in managing severe pest infestations when used judiciously. The key is to use pesticides that are targeted, berkesan, and have minimal impact on non-target organisms and the environment. Farmers should follow label instructions carefully and consider using biopesticides, which are derived from natural sources and are often less harmful to the environment.

Government Support and Community Involvement

Effective pest control also requires the support of governments and communities. Governments can play a crucial role in providing resources, latihan, and policies that promote sustainable pest management practices. Community involvement, such as farmer cooperatives and shared pest management programs, can enhance information sharing and collective action against pests.

Conclusion

Kesimpulannya, the best practice for controlling agricultural pests involves a combination of monitoring, early warning systems, integrated pest management, biological control, cultural practices, physical control methods, and judicious use of chemicals. Di samping itu, government support and community involvement are essential in promoting sustainable pest management practices. By adopting these strategies, farmers can protect their crops, enhance food security, and contribute to the preservation of our natural environment.
